Tides do more than raise and lower the shoreline. They can expose hazards, cover a useful sandbank, change current through channels and alter whether a wave spills, plunges or fails to break in its usual place.
A tide table gives predicted water level and time, not wave quality. Wind, swell direction, period and recent movement of sand still determine what happens at the beach.
Common effects—not universal rules
| Tide stage | Possible effect | Potential concern |
|---|---|---|
| Low | Reveals shallow banks and reef shape | Dumping waves, exposed rocks or insufficient depth |
| Rising | Adds water and changes current | Rapidly changing entry and exit |
| High | Covers banks and reaches farther up beach | Backwash, shorebreak or waves not breaking normally |
| Falling | Removes water and can strengthen channel flow | Changing currents and exposed hazards |
Why local bathymetry controls the result
Bathymetry is the underwater shape of the seabed. Beachbreak sandbars move, sometimes after a storm or large swell. Reef and point breaks are more fixed but can be highly sensitive to water depth. That is why a remembered tide recommendation can become unreliable at a shifting beachbreak.
Observe where waves break, where water returns seaward and whether the planned exit remains usable. An outgoing tide combined with a rip or channel may make returning to shore more difficult.
A safer way to learn a break
- Check official tide times, weather warnings and surf hazards.
- Visit at different tide stages without assuming you must enter.
- Ask qualified local lifeguards or instructors about hazards.
- Note fixed landmarks rather than relying only on an app label.
- Reassess after storms because sand and access can change.

Frequently asked questions
Is high tide better for surfing?
Not universally. It may add useful depth at one break and stop waves breaking well or create backwash at another.
Is low tide dangerous?
It can expose shallow sand, reef or rocks and create dumping waves. The hazard depends on the break and conditions.
Does a rising tide always improve waves?
No. A rising tide changes water depth and current, but wave quality depends on the individual break and the rest of the forecast.
